Central Secretary of the Mothers' Union in 1925. In 1926 was quoted in newspapers as opposed to divorce, supporting a MU decision to deny membership to a divorced woman.

Noël Barclay
Central President of the Mothers' Union in 1925. We found reference to a publication probably authored by her: Barclay, E. Noel, Marriage and Divorce (1936).
